Here is our 2002 Hyundai Accent GS. Wife and I bought it new in May of 02 and have had it all accross the US. It has been the best little car ever. When we first bought it I could not stand the looks of it so I bought 15" wheels for it along with a "Talon" body kit from Australia and it transformed the looks of the car. We even have received many compliments believe it or not. The only thing it no longer has the front spoiler, wife busted it off pulling into our drive and hit the end curb. I also replaced the front fascia with the Canadian version so I could have factory fog lights. (not avail. in the US) I also added side marker lights from the Aussie version as well. And I even replaced the air intake with a real carbon fiber ram air induction. (tuners take note). Now the car is equipped with pwr. windows, pwr steering and brakes, COLD ac, rear wiper, and factory cd player. Tires were just replaced a couple months ago. Ever since my first oil change I have always used Mobil 1 synthetic and it does not smoke, leak or burn any oil out of the 1.6 litre. I have tons of paperwork, reciepts, original window sticker and books. Car drives great doesn't pull to either side and brakes are good. The body is starting to show its age, getting a little rust around the rear wheel wells and the paint still shines great. Some of the clear is coming off of the mouldings though. Now a couple of months ago the tranny started to act up in the overdrive, kincking in and out and caused a check engine light to come on. Had it checked out and the tranny shop told me the the 4th gear servo was going out and we never fixed it but still runs down the highway no problem without the O/D and that is how we've been driving it. We average around 30 mpg so it's very economical. We finally decided to buy a new car and is why we are now selling her. Even if you don't buy this one I highly reconmend buying a Hyundai product.
